It is difficult, painful and necessary – about the liberalization of the economy in Kazakhstan
taj.report

It is difficult, painful and necessary – about the liberalization of the economy in Kazakhstan

The state is still involved in the economy In May of this year, the Presidential Decree "On measures to liberalize the economy" was issued. The document is aimed at ensuring freedom of entrepreneurship through the development of competition, reducing state participation in the economy and reducing business costs.

The war that did not blow up the market: how the world defused the 2026 oil shock

The war that did not blow up the market: how the world defused the 2026 oil shock

The effective closure of the Strait of Hormuz became the largest oil supply disruption in history. But the global market did not go into an uncontrolled price spiral. The shock was sharp, but shorter than the most severe forecasts had anticipated. This is a story not only about oil, but also about which forecasting methods work better under conditions of war, physical supply shortage, and high uncertainty.
